With the early advent of the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2, which will happen late in September, we can expect some brands to hasten the launch of their respective flagships. Xiaomi is one of the brands that launches new flagships shortly after Qualcomm every year. This has been happening with the past generations of its former Mi flagships (now only numbered flagships). That said, we can expect the Xiaomi 16 series to pop between October and November this year. That might explain why some of the specifications are popping out at this point. The Xiaomi 16 is the latest device to have its specs leaked by the tipster Digital Chat Station.
Xiaomi 16 Specs Leak – Significant Upgrades in Battery and Camera Department
According to the tipster, the Xiaomi 16 will come with the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2, which is hardly a surprise at this point. The Xiaomi 15 was one of the first devices with the Snapdragon 8 Elite, and we expect the Xiaomi 16 to keep this mark. The device is said to feature three 50 MP rear cameras. There will be one with a 1/1.3″ sensor, an ultrawide, and a telemacro camera. As you can imagine, the latter will have some level of zooming capabilities and will double as a macro module when needed.
The phone will come with a 6,500 mAh battery. That’s a great capacity considering that the Xiaomi 16 should be the slimmer and more compact variant of the family. It will sport a 6.3-inch flat OLED screen with thin bezels on all sides. We expect the punch-hole design to return for the selfie camera as well as an under-screen fingerprint scanner. It is worth noting that its design leaked recently, and shows some small changes over the 15 series.
None of the above specifications comes as a big surprise. We can see some welcome upgrades like the bigger battery. If the numbers are accurate, there will be a nice upgrade over the Xiaomi 15 and its 5240. It’s even better than the Xiaomi 15 Pro battery which had 6,100mAh capacity. Another interesting addition is the presence of the telemacro shooter. It’s not being called as periscope by Digital Chat Station, so it partially contradicts some rumors pointing to a periscope camera with the Xiaomi 16.
Considering the whole package, the Xiaomi 16 won’t be an extraordinary upgrade over its predecessor. There are some nice improvements like a bigger battery, new cameras, and, of course, the presumably faster, Snapdragon 8 Elite 2. However, it may not be the biggest upgrade for those who already have a Xiaomi 15. It will still do the job well in most of what we expect from a flagship.
